一起学习网 一起学习网

MySQL数据库搭建从代码到实施(code mysql)

MySQL数据库搭建:从代码到实施

MySQL是一种常用的关系型数据库管理系统,用于管理互联网上的大量数据。在本文中,我们将探讨如何从代码到实施搭建MySQL数据库。

第一步:获取MySQL

在开始搭建前,我们需要从MySQL官方网站下载MySQL服务。MySQL支持多种不同的操作系统,包括Windows、Linux和MacOS。安装过程中需要注意一些重要参数,例如IP地址、端口号、用户名、密码等等,这些参数将决定MySQL在操作系统中的运行方式。

第二步:MySQL配置

完成MySQL安装后,我们需要对MySQL进行一些配置,包括更改默认密码、添加新的用户、授权等等。下面是通过SQL语句更改默认密码的代码:

“`mysql

mysql> ALTER USER ‘root’@’localhost’ IDENTIFIED WITH mysql_native_password BY ‘new_password’;


以上代码将root用户对localhost的认证方式更改为mysql_native_password,并将登录密码更改为“new_password”。

第三步:创建数据库

完成MySQL的配置后,我们需要创建一个或多个数据库用于存储数据。下面是创建一个名为“test”的数据库的SQL代码:

```mysql
mysql> CREATE DATABASE test;

此处我们创建了一个名为“test”的数据库,用于存储数据。

第四步:创建表格

在数据库中,我们需要创建表格用于存储特定类型的数据。下面是创建一个名为“users”的表格的SQL代码:

“`mysql

mysql> CREATE TABLE users (

id INT(6) UNSIGNED AUTO_INCREMENT PRIMARY KEY,

firstname VARCHAR(30) NOT NULL,

lastname VARCHAR(30) NOT NULL,

eml VARCHAR(50),

reg_date TIMESTAMP D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P

);


以上代码将创建一个名为“users”的表格,包含id、firstname、lastname、eml和reg_date这些字段。其中,id为自增的主键,reg_date将在插入数据时自动更新。

第五步:插入数据

在创建了表格后,我们需要向表格中插入数据。下面是向“users”表格中插入一条记录的SQL代码:

```mysql
mysql> INSERT INTO users (firstname, lastname, eml)
VALUES ('John', 'Doe', 'john@example.com');

以上代码将向“users”表格中插入一条记录,其中firstname、lastname和eml这三个字段被赋予了特定的值。

第六步:查询数据

在插入了数据后,我们需要从表格中查询数据。下面是从“users”表格中查询所有记录的SQL代码:

“`mysql

mysql> SELECT * FROM users;


以上代码将从“users”表格中查询所有的记录,并将其返回给用户。

结论:

通过本文的介绍,我们了解了MySQL数据库的搭建过程,包括下载MySQL服务、配置MySQL、创建数据库、创建表格、插入数据和查询数据。在MySQL的使用过程中,我们需要关注数据库的安全性、性能和可靠性,以确保MySQL对数据进行有效的管理、存储和交互。